logo

Output e0021663bd2c1d7a025227ef65d81cc9a9bd36f24423d7d324918aac8180e2ec:1

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f127f9c4164fc783bb821bf208c70b7bbf9d0012 OP_EQUAL
address
3Pg8fLBqFfJB5EXqFJCmeSi5M9QTUpWu8h
transaction
e0021663bd2c1d7a025227ef65d81cc9a9bd36f24423d7d324918aac8180e2ec